# OpenTelemetry Demo with .NET 9, Serilog, and .NET Aspire
This project demonstrates a comprehensive OpenTelemetry setup using .NET 9, Serilog, and .NET Aspire with its built-in observability dashboard.
## Features
- **.NET 9** ASP.NET Core Web API
- **OpenTelemetry** integration for traces, metrics, and logs
- **Serilog** with OpenTelemetry sink for structured logging
- **.NET Aspire** for local development orchestration with built-in observability dashboard
- **Scalar** API documentation UI for easy API testing and exploration
- All telemetry (logs, traces, metrics) automatically routed to Aspire Dashboard## Comprehensive Feature Demonstrations

### OpenTelemetry Configuration
The `ServiceDefaults` project contains centralized OpenTelemetry configuration:
- **Traces**: ASP.NET Core and HTTP client instrumentation
- **Metrics**: Runtime, process, and custom metrics
- **Logs**: Serilog integration with OpenTelemetry sink### Custom Instrumentation
The API includes examples of:
- Custom ActivitySource for distributed tracing
- Custom Meters for business metrics
- Structured logging with trace correlation
- Error handling with proper telemetry### Endpoints

### Environment Variables
- `ASPNETCORE_ENVIRONMENT` - Environment name (Development/Production)
- Aspire automatically configures `OTEL_EXPORTER_OTLP_ENDPOINT` when running### Serilog Configuration
Serilog is configured to:
- Write to console with structured output
- Send logs to OpenTelemetry collector via OTLP
- Include trace and span IDs for correlation
- Enrich logs with environment and thread information## Troubleshooting

## Advanced Usage
### Adding Custom Metrics
```csharp
var meter = new Meter("YourApp", "1.0.0");
var counter = meter.CreateCounter("custom_metric");
counter.Add(1, new("tag", "value"));
```### Adding Custom Traces
```csharp
using var activity = ActivitySource.StartActivity("CustomOperation");
activity?.SetTag("custom.tag", "value");
```### Benefits of Using Aspire Dashboard
